wheel trim placement
Nils Hallberg
I own the red 71 with the black droptop, numbers matching in the club members cars. I'm getting ready to do a ground up restoration. Can someone tell me the correct length of the wheel trim? I have all new trim and would like to as accurate as possible I've seen Sx's with the trim completely around the wheel well and with it stopping at the body trim. Mine has two wheel wells stopping at the side trim and two going down to the opening ends. Will be post pictures as the car progress in both body and upgrades to the engine while still keeping it numbers matching.
Brian Foster
Nils, I am no expert but from what I can tell the wheel trim should stop at the body trim. This is the best I found from my research. Great looking SX by the way.
Gary Goodman
I'm also not an expert. My 71 SX currently has the wheel moldings going to the bottom of the panel BUT I have photos taken before a previous owner painted the car and it shows the moldings stopping at the body side molding. My guess is that is original and correct and during the repaint the moldings were replaced with incorrect ones.
